Decoding "Undefined": A Professional Guide to Its Meaning and Management

In the realm of programming, few concepts are as fundamental and yet as frequently misunderstood as Undefined. This primitive value represents a variable that has been declared but not assigned a value, a missing property, or a function with no explicit return. Grasping the nuances of Undefined is crucial for writing robust, error-free code and is a cornerstone of professional software development. This article will delve into its definition, common causes, and best practices for handling it effectively.

1. What Exactly Does "Undefined" Mean?

The term Undefined signifies the absence of a defined value. In JavaScript, for instance, it is a primitive type and a global property. A variable is Undefined when it has been initialized but lacks an assigned value. It is distinct from `null`, which is an intentional assignment representing "no value." Understanding this distinction is vital; `null` is an object, while Undefined is a type itself. This primitive value often appears implicitly, signaling that the engine cannot find a value for a given identifier.

2. Common Scenarios Where "Undefined" Appears

Encountering an Undefined value is a daily occurrence for developers. Typical scenarios include: accessing an object property that does not exist, calling a function that does not return a value, using a variable before its declaration (in non-strict mode), or providing fewer arguments than a function expects. Each instance of Undefined serves as a feedback mechanism from the runtime, indicating a specific gap in data or logic that requires the developer's attention to prevent potential runtime errors.

3. The Critical Difference: Undefined vs. Null

A common point of confusion is differentiating between Undefined and null. While both represent an absence of value, they are used differently. Undefined is typically a system-level, uninitialized state assigned by the JavaScript engine. In contrast, null is a developer-assigned value that explicitly denotes "no object" or "empty." Using strict equality checks (`===`) helps distinguish them, as `undefined === null` evaluates to false. Recognizing when a value is intentionally null versus accidentally Undefined is key to debugging and data integrity.

4. Best Practices for Handling Undefined Values

Proactively managing Undefined states is essential for code reliability. Strategies include: always initializing variables upon declaration, using the `typeof` operator to check for Undefined safely, employing default parameters in functions, and utilizing optional chaining (`?.`) and nullish coalescing (`??`) operators in modern JavaScript. Defensive coding practices, such as explicit checks before using potentially Undefined variables, can prevent the infamous `TypeError` and enhance application stability.

5. Undefined in Debugging and Type Systems

The appearance of an Undefined value is often the first clue in debugging. Modern development tools and linters can flag potential Undefined references. Furthermore, in typed languages or supersets like TypeScript, developers can leverage strict type definitions (`string | undefined`) to make the potential for an Undefined state explicit at compile time, thereby catching errors early and reducing runtime surprises related to uninitialized values.
